Cricket has always witnessed many tall cricketers who added a different flavor to the game. Pakistan’s Mohammad Irfan is a prime example whose height makes it awkward for many batters to play him. However, this time the fans are thrilled to see a giant-sized fan who belongs from Afghanistan and is a die-hard fan of the blue team.
Afghanistan is currently playing West Indies in a three-game ODI series, which will be followed by 3 T20Is and a solitary Test.
All the cricket action is happening in Lucknow, India which is experiencing an influx of Afghan fans to cheer their team. These fans include a special man called Sher Khan who possesses a height of 8 feet and 2 inches.

The man-mountain has traveled all the way from Kabul to back his team while they are featuring against India. However, he suffered a lot of trouble as he wasn’t able to find a room big enough for him. For this to happen, he was taken to a police station which could help him get accommodation.
Eventually, the cops at Naka Police Station helped him to get a place after verifying his documents. Sher Khan calls himself an ardent fan of cricket and sits optimistically about Afghanistan’s chances in the ongoing tour against West Indies.
